How they compare
Mauritania currently reports 22.48 against 18.87 in Namibia, a difference of 3.61.
That makes Mauritania's figure about 1.2 times Namibia's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2017 it was Namibia ahead.
Mauritania ranks 62nd and Namibia ranks 64th of 113 countries.
Mauritania has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
